Manila, March 19 -- The Land Transportation Office's (LTO) intensified campaign against fixers got a big boost with the conviction of six individuals by two separate courts in Cagayan province.

In a statement on Wednesday, the LTO said Rufelyn Bayaca was convicted in all four cases filed before a court in Gataran town, Cagayan -- including falsification of public documents and violation of the Anti-Red Tape Law, or Republic Act 9845.

On the other hand, Mirasol Ramos, Elvira Donato, Elsie Ramos, Jesie Macapulay, and Jenno Bruar were convicted of three criminal charges filed against them before a court in Tuao town, Cagayan in connection with illegal LTO transactions.

All six were meted with a maximum sentence of three-year imprisonment...
